Step 1: Identify Triggers

The first step in addressing bladder discomfort is to identify potential triggers that may be exacerbating your symptoms. Common triggers include certain foods and beverages, stress, dehydration, and underlying medical conditions. By keeping a journal of your symptoms and activities, you can start to pinpoint what may be causing your discomfort.

Step 2: Make Lifestyle Changes

Once you have identified your triggers, the next step is to make necessary lifestyle changes to help alleviate your symptoms. This may include adjusting your diet to avoid trigger foods, staying hydrated, managing stress through relaxation techniques, and incorporating regular exercise into your routine. These changes can have a significant impact on reducing bladder discomfort.

Step 3: Seek Professional Help

If you continue to experience bladder discomfort despite making lifestyle changes, it’s crucial to seek professional help. A healthcare provider can help determine if there are underlying medical conditions contributing to your symptoms and recommend appropriate treatment options. This may include medications, physical therapy, or other interventions tailored to your specific needs.
